1. What is the Weight Loss Calculator By Date?

The Weight Loss Calculator By Date helps determine a healthy weekly weight loss rate based on your starting weight, goal weight, and the timeframe you want to achieve it in. It calculates a safe and sustainable weight loss range of 0.5-1 kg per week.

3. Importance of Healthy Weight Loss

Details: Losing weight at a rate of 0.5-1 kg per week is considered safe and sustainable. Rapid weight loss can lead to muscle loss, nutritional deficiencies, and weight regain. This calculator helps you set realistic goals and maintain healthy habits.

5.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q1: Why is 0.5-1 kg per week considered healthy?
A: This rate allows for fat loss while preserving muscle mass, ensures adequate nutrition, and promotes long-term weight maintenance.

Q2: What if my calculated rate is outside this range?
A: If your timeline requires faster loss, consider extending your timeframe or consulting a healthcare professional for guidance.

Q3: Does this account for plateaus?
A: No, weight loss is rarely linear. This calculator provides an ideal rate - actual progress may vary with plateaus and fluctuations.

Q4: Should I adjust my calorie intake based on this?
A: Yes, a deficit of approximately 500-1000 calories per day typically results in 0.5-1 kg weight loss per week.

Q5: Is this calculator suitable for everyone?
A: While generally safe, individuals with medical conditions should consult healthcare providers before starting any weight loss program.
